Web Hosting Service options

Hey hey fellow treehousserrss..sists...erm.. coughs

Right my question! I've been looking up at various web hosting services and I see a massive difference in the big sharks like Dreamhost.com and such and the services available in my country. Not only are they cheaper but they seem to offer quite a lot more.

So my question is.. should I just go for a big company even if, i guess, the servers are located quite aways? Or should I stick with the options my country provides.

I'd also like to ask if buying the domains and the hosting from the same company has any benefits. Does it really matter?

You should get hosting where your target audience is. If most of the people going to you website are in your country id recommend getting hosting there. Lets say you get hosting in America and most of your users are from your country(not american I donno) then it will take longer to send data the farther the connection is. Also consider pricing, features etc... Make sure your hosting allows mysql and php. Id also look for a nice back end as well like cpanel or pleask although those arent great but they are a lot better than most out there
